Bug confirmed (but I didn't try all your workarounds, just the no spaces
before the #+begin_src and no space after the colon in the #+name).

I take it it was working on 7.4?

Nick

PS. One side note: the syntax of code blocks is

     #+NAME: <name>
     #+BEGIN_SRC <language> <switches> <header arguments>
       <body>
     #+END_SRC

so no emacs-lisp on the #+end_src line.
